Quick Summary
The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ers (USACE), St. Paul District, is soliciting bids for Mechanical Unloading of Islands and Dredging in the Mississippi and Minnesota Rivers across Minnesota, Wisconsin, and Iowa. This is an Indefinite Delivery, Indefinite Quantity (IDIQ) contract issued as an Invitation for Bids (IFB), with an estimated magnitude of $10,000,000 to $25,000,000. This opportunity is a Total Small Business Set-Aside. Bids are due March 17, 2026.
Scope of Work
The work involves furnishing all plant, labor, material, and equipment necessary for island unloading and/or dredging operations. This includes using backhoes, draglines, other mechanical equipment, or marine plants. Contractors will also be responsible for the transportation of dredged material to designated USACE placement sites within the specified area of responsibility.
Contract & Timeline
- Type: Indefinite Delivery, Indefinite Quantity (IDIQ)
- Solicitation Type: Invitation for Bids (IFB) in accordance with FAR Part 14
- Duration: A base 12-month period of performance with options for two (2) additional 12-month periods.
- Estimated Magnitude: $10,000,000 to $25,000,000
- Set-Aside: Total Small Business Set-Aside (FAR 19.5)
- NAICS: 237990 Other Heavy and Civil Engineering Construction (Size Standard: $45 Million)
- Bid Opening: March 17, 2026, 19:00 UTC
- Published: March 10, 2026
